Report 1 - Budget Footnote Creating the Wyoming Tourism Board
Tourism Board in the Business Council approved by Wyoming House and Senate. February 20, 2003. The Board will function until the end of this budget cycle June 30, 2004. The budget footnote:
- There is created the Wyoming tourism board within the Wyoming business council.
- The tourism board is composed of nine (9) members appointed by the governor. The governor may remove any member as provided by W.S. 9-1-202. Members of the board shall be employed in or associated with the travel industry. Two (2) members shall be designated as at-large members of the board. Of the seven (7) remaining members, one (1) each shall be appointed from each of the appointment districts set forth in W.S. 9-1-218.
- The tourism board shall be responsible for implementing the tourism program and functions assigned to the Wyoming business council under the Wyoming economic development act, including the expenditure of all funds appropriated for this program.
- The tourism board shall be subject to oversight by the Wyoming business council to assure compliance with the Wyoming economic development act.
- Members of the tourism board shall be compensated in the same manner as members of the Wyoming business council.
- The tourism board shall be appointed and begin exercising its powers no later than April 1, 2003. The board shall exist until June 30, 2004. Upon termination of the board, its powers shall pass and be vested in the Wyoming business council.
